People Score in 44311, Akron, Ohio

The People Score for the Breast Cancer Score in 44311, Akron, Ohio is 7 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 74.71 percent of the residents in 44311 has some form of health insurance. 49.83 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 29.53 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 44311 would have to travel an average of 1.04 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Akron General Medical Center. In a 20-mile radius, there are 13,691 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 44311, Akron, Ohio.

Understanding the demographics is crucial to deciphering the breast cancer score. Factors like age, race, and socioeconomic status play a significant role. We know that the incidence of breast cancer increases with age, so a population with a higher proportion of older adults may see a different profile than one with a younger demographic. Similarly, disparities in healthcare access and cultural practices can influence screening rates and treatment outcomes.

The choices we make about smoking and alcohol consumption also have a significant impact. Smoking is a known risk factor for several cancers, and excessive alcohol consumption is linked to an increased risk of breast cancer.
